Anaerobic exercise, such as weight training, is great for getting rid of flab, especially those trouble spots like belly fat, underarm flab, and flabby thighs. Anaerobic exercise builds muscle more so than aerobic exercise, which mostly burns fat.

Cardiovascular exercise is the only way to reduce fat. You can't "spot remove" fat on the hips, calves, butt, etc. Losing weight through cardio and weight training exercises that focus on the calves will give them a lot more definition though. ~ T
